On Site Filing of Securing a Building Permit & Other Construction Related Permits (Highly Technical Applications)
Covers on-site application for a Building Permit and other construction-related permits for Highly Technical projects under PD 1096 (the National Building Code of the Philippines) — including commercial and market buildings exceeding 9 storeys, hospitals and mental health facilities, large public assembly buildings, disaster-response structures, and special structures such as aerodromes, historical buildings, wind turbines, and towers.

Requirements
| Requirements | Where to Secure |
|---|---|
| PRINTED Construction Occupational Safety and Health (COSH) Program Application Reference Number from DOLE Office (2 copies). Note: Submit Affidavit of Undertaking if the approval of the COSH Program is still on process. | Department of Labor and Employment Office |
| Locational Clearance (3 original copies) |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(Zoning Officer/Zoning Administrator) |
| Notarized Unified Application Form for Building Permit, duly accomplished, signed and sealed over printed names by licensed Architect or Civil Engineer (full-time supervisor or inspector of construction) (5 original copies) |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2) |
| Ancillary and Accessory Permit Forms, duly accomplished, signed and sealed over printed names by licensed and registered professionals (5 original copies) |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2) |
| Photocopies of valid IDs: Licenses of all involved professionals (i.e., Professional Tax Receipt for the current year & valid PRC ID, 1 photocopy, signed and sealed); Community Tax Certificate for the current year and valid ID of the applicant (1 photocopy) | All professionals involved in the project; City Treasury Office – Window 4 & 5 / Barangay Hall |
| Complete set of plans prepared, signed and sealed over printed names of the duly licensed and registered professionals with the conformity of the owner (4 Sets): a. Geodetic Engineer, in case of Lot Survey Plans (Note: submit Affidavit of Undertaking to conduct land survey prior to construction, in the absence of lot survey plans); b. Architect, in case of Architectural plans and documents (Note: for architectural interior/interior design documents, either an architect or interior designer may sign); c. Civil Engineer, in case of Civil/Structural plans and documents; d. Professional Electrical Engineer, in case of Electrical plans and documents; e. Professional Mechanical Engineer, in case of mechanical plans and documents; f. Sanitary Engineer, in case of sanitary plans and documents; g. Master Plumber, in case of plumbing plans and documents; h. Electronics Engineer, in case of electronics plans and documents | Design professionals |
| Notarized Estimated Cost of the proposed work or Bill of Materials, duly signed and sealed by Licensed Architect/Civil Engineer with the conformity of the owner (4 original copies) | Licensed Architect or Civil Engineer of the project |
| Specifications, duly signed and sealed by Licensed Architect/Civil Engineer with the conformity of the owner (4 original copies) | Design professionals |
| Assessment of Building Permit Fees (1 original copy, 3 photocopies) |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2) |
| Receipt of Building Permit Fees and Signboard (1 original copy, 3 photocopies) | City Treasury Office - Window 4, 5, 6, 7 |
| Logbook, signed and sealed by the full-time inspector and supervisor of construction works (1 copy) | Licensed Architect or Civil Engineer (full-time supervisor or inspector of construction works) |
| For applicants who are the REGISTERED owner of the lot: Certified true copy of OCT/TCT on file with the Registry of Deeds (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Registry of Deeds |
| For applicants who are the REGISTERED owner of the lot: Certified true copy of Tax Declaration (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| City Assessor's Office |
| For applicants who are the REGISTERED owner of the lot: Current Real Property Tax Receipt (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| City Treasury Office - Window 9, 10, 11 |
| For applicants who are NOT the registered owner of the lot (in addition to the above): Duly notarized Contract of Lease (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Notary Public |
| For applicants who are NOT the registered owner of the lot: or Notarized Deed of Sale or Notarized Deed of Donation (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Notary Public |
| For applicants who are NOT the registered owner of the lot: or Notarized Affidavit of Consent of the owner/administrator (1 original copy, 2 photocopies), with attached Community Tax Certificate for the current year and valid ID of the lot owner/administrator (1 photocopy) | Notary Public; City Treasury Office – Window 4 & 5 / Barangay Hall |
| For Government lots: Certificate of Award (3 photocopies) | Not specified in the Citizen's Charter |
| If the building/structure requires an electrical permit: Electrical Design Analysis, Schedule of Loads and Short Circuit Calculation, duly signed and sealed by a Professional Electrical Engineer (1 original copy, 3 photocopies) | Professional Electrical Engineer of the project |
| If the building/structure requires an electrical permit: Fire Safety Evaluation Clearance, Endorsement and receipt issued (1 original copy, 3 photocopies) |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office -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P 1 & BFP 2) |
| For three (3) storey structures or 7.50 meters high, and more: Structural Design Analysis and Design Computations, duly signed and sealed by a Licensed Civil Engineer (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Licensed Civil Engineer |
| For three (3) storey structures or 7.50 meters high, and more: Geotechnical Report and Soil Boring Test Certification, duly signed and sealed by a Licensed Geotechnical Engineer (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Licensed Geotechnical Engineer |
| For four (4) storey structures or 12 meters high, and more: Fire Suppression System Plan, computations and specification, signed and sealed (4 original copies) | Licensed Fire Protection Engineer |
| For four (4) storey structures or 12 meters high, and more: Elevator System plan, specifications, and computations (4 original copies) | Licensed Mechanical Engineer |
| For structures 50 meters high or 10,000 sq. meters or more; hospitals with 50 beds or more; or schools with 20 classrooms and 3 storeys or more: Application for installation of an accelerogram, with baseline parameters and seismic analysis (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Not specified in the Citizen's Charter |
| For structures 75 meters high or more: Structural Design Peer Review (1 original copy, 2 photocopies) | Not specified in the Citizen's Charter |
Step-by-Step Process
Submit accomplished application form and required documents at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2)
Agency Action
Review the submitted documents and attach checklist of requirements and evaluation checklist
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 hour · Administrative Assistant III (Alternates: Administrative Aide, Construction and Maintenance Man, Administrative Assistant II, Administrative Assistant VI)
No action required from the client at this step.
Agency Action
1.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Land Use & Zoning
Fee: None · Processing Time: 2 days · Zoning Administrator Designate (Alternates: Zoning Officer I, Architect II)
2.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Line & Grade
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Engineer II (Alternates: Engineer III)
3.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Architectural
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Supervising Administrative Officer (Alternates: Architect III, Architect II)
4.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Civil/Structural
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Acting Assistant City Building Official (Alternates: Engineer III, Engineer II)
5.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Plumbing
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Architect II (Alternates: Zoning Officer I, Administrative Assistant III)
6.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Electrical
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Engineer III (Alternates: Engineer I)
7.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Sanitary
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Acting City Building Official or Acting Assistant City Building Official
8.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Electronics
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Acting City Building Official or Acting Assistant City Building Official
9.Conduct evaluation of plans and documents submitted – Mechanical
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Acting City Building Official or Acting Assistant City Building Official
10.Schedule and conduct inspection and verification
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Inspectorate Team
11.Assessment of plans for order of payment
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 day · Administrative Assistant III
12.Review and print order of payment
Fee: None · Processing Time: 1 hour · Supervising Administrative Officer (Alternates: Architect II, Engineer II, Architect III, Engineer III, Zoning Officer I)
13.Sign for approval of order of payment
Fee: None · Processing Time: Not specified in the Citizen's Charter · Acting City Building Official (Or Acting Assistant City Building Official, Or Supervising Administrative Officer)
14.Prepare and print fire endorsement, if needed
Fee: None · Processing Time: 5 minutes · Construction and Maintenance Man (Alternates: Administrative Assistant III, Administrative Assistant VI)
15.Sign fire endorsement
Fee: None · Processing Time: Not specified in the Citizen's Charter · Acting City Building Official (Or Acting Assistant City Building Official, Or Supervising Administrative Officer)
Proceed to City Treasury Office for the payment of fees and present the official receipt at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2). Make sure to secure the Official Receipt that will be issued upon payment.
Agency Action
Accept the payment based on the Order of Payment
Fee: Documentary Stamp Php 30.00; ICT Fee Php 25.00; Signboard Php 200.00; Inspection & Verification Php 200.00; Locational Clearance fee based on the assessment of fees; Building permit fees based on the assessment of fees · Processing Time: 2 minutes · City Treasury Office Staff
No action required from the client at this step.
Agency Action
1.Prepare the necessary documents of permit for the approval of Acting City Building Official or Acting Assistant City Building Official
Fee: None · Processing Time: 2 days · Administrative Assistant VI (Alternates: Construction and Maintenance Man, Administrative Aide)
2.Approve the permit
Fee: None · Processing Time: Not specified in the Citizen's Charter · Acting City Building Official (Or Acting Assistant City Building Official)
Receive the approved permit and signboard and sign in the Building Permit Logbook at Business One-Stop-Shop (BOSS) Office (CEO 2)
Agency Action
Release the approved permit to the client
Fee: None · Processing Time: 5 minutes · Administrative Assistant III (Alternates: Administrative Aide, Construction and Maintenance Man, Administrative Assistant II, Administrative Assistant VI)
